Fernbank Natural History Museum – Atlanta, Georgia

The Fernbank Natural History Museum is one of the top natural history museums in the southeast. Their permanent exhibits include a timeline of Georgia history, dinosaurs, shells and a hands-on discovery room for younger children. The most popular draw for my son – the dinosaur exhibit, of course.
